Are routers connected to phone lines?

Are routers connected to phone lines?

Wireless routers plug into modems, not phone jacks. The router needs a secondary piece of equipment — a modem — to make the Internet connection. DSL modems use phone lines to connect your network to the Internet, and the router connects to the modem, not the phone line.

How does wifi work on landlines?

Your telephone line is effectively split into two lines: a voice channel, that works as before, by circuit switching, and a data channel that can constantly send and receive packets of digital data to or from your computer by packet switching, which is the very fast and efficient way in which data is sent across the …

Do I need a landline for WiFi?

You don’t have to use a phone line in order to get internet. In fact, other types of internet are becoming more and more popular, as most homes can access cheap internet service without a phone line. Depending on where you live, your budget, and the internet speeds you need, there are many options for you.

What does a modem do on a landline?

If you have a landline, and you use dial up to access ( not a Cell phone with tethering or with wifi Access point abilities ) a remote computer or the internet, you are going to use a modem. The modem takes 1s and 0s from the computer and turns it into a modulated noise that the analog phone system can transmit.

Can I connect two modems to the same phone line?

Typical home routers are likely to combine both router and modem functions. You can’t connect two separate modems to the same phone line, but you could instead slave one of the routers to the other. This may be as simple as connecting an Ethernet cable between any two ports of the two boxes.
